七氟烷预处理对1-甲基-4苯基-1,2,3,4-四氢吡啶诱导的急性帕金森病小鼠的神经保护作用

摘  要:目的探讨七氟烷预处理对1-甲基-4苯基-1,2,3,4-四氢吡啶(MPTP)诱导的急性帕金森病(PD)小鼠的神经保护作用。方法选取36只SPF级雄性C57BL/6小鼠并随机分为4组,每组9只。七氟烷组暴露于2%七氟烷2h,PD组腹腔注射MPTP20mg/kg,七氟烷预处理+PD组预先暴露于2%七氟烷2h,复苏后于小鼠腹腔注射MPTP,对照组腹腔注射等剂量0.9%氯化钠溶液。比较4组行为学指标、黑质区酪氨酸羟化酶(TH)阳性神经元数量、脑组织炎症因子[白细胞介素-1β(IL-1β)、白细胞介素-6(IL-6)、肿瘤坏死因子-α(TNF-α)]水平、氧化应激指标[丙二醛(MDA)、谷胱甘肽(GSH)]水平。结果PD组、七氟烷预处理+PD组悬挂试验掉落潜伏期均短于对照组、七氟烷组,悬挂试验评分低于对照组、七氟烷组,爬杆试验转向时间、总时间均长于对照组、七氟烷组,且七氟烷预处理+PD组悬挂试验掉落潜伏期长于PD组,悬挂试验评分高于PD组,爬杆试验转向时间、总时间均短于PD组,差异有统计学意义(P<0.05)。PD组、七氟烷预处理+PD组黑质区TH阳性神经元数量均少于对照组、七氟烷组,七氟烷预处理+PD组黑质区TH阳性神经元数量多于PD组,差异有统计学意义(P<0.05)。PD组、七氟烷预处理+PD组脑组织IL-1β、IL-6、TNF-α水平均高于对照组、七氟烷组,七氟烷预处理+PD组脑组织IL-1β、IL-6、TNF-α水平低于PD组,差异有统计学意义(P<0.05)。PD组、七氟烷预处理+PD组脑组织MDA水平均高于对照组、七氟烷组,GSH水平低于对照组、七氟烷组,且七氟烷预处理+PD组脑组织MDA水平低于PD组,GSH水平高于PD组,差异有统计学意义(P<0.05)。结论七氟烷预处理对MPTP诱导的急性PD模型小鼠具有保护作用,可改善运动功能,其作用机制可能与七氟烷预处理的抗炎、抗氧化应激相关。Objective To investigate the neuroprotective effect of sevoflurane preconditioning on 1-methyl-4-phenyl-1,2,3,6-tetrahydropyri-dine(MPTP)induced acute Parkinson's disease(PD)in mice.Methods 36 SPF male C57BL/6 mice were selected and randomly divided into 4 groups,with 9 mice in each group.The sevoflurane group was exposed to 2%sevoflurane for 2 h,the PD group was intraperitoneally injected with MPTP 20 mg/kg,the sevoflurane pretreatment+PD group was pre-exposed to 2%sevoflurane for 2 h,and the mice were intraperitoneally injected with MPTP after resuscitation,the control group was intraperitoneally injected with the equal dose of 0.9%sodium chloride solution.The behavioral indexes,the number of tyrosine hydroxylase(TH)positive neurons in substantia nigra,the levels of inflammatory factors(interleukin-1β[IL-1β],in-terleukin-6[IL-6],tumor necrosis factor-α[TNF-α])and oxidative stress(malondialdehyde[MDA]and glutathione[GSH])in brain tissues were com-pared among the four groups.Results The falling latency of suspension test in the PD group and the sevoflurane pretreatment+PD group was short-er than that in the control group and the sevoflurane group,the suspension test score was lower than that in the control group and the sevoflurane group,the turning time and total time of pole climbing test were longer than those in the control group and the sevoflurane group,and the falling la-tency of suspension test in the sevoflurane pretreatment+PD group was longer than that in the PD group,the suspension test score was higher than that in the PD group,the turning time and total time of pole climbing test were shorter than those in the PD group,the differences were statistically significant(P<0.05).The number of TH positive neurons in substantia nigra in the PD group and the sevoflurane preconditioning+PD group was less than that in the control group and sevoflurane group,and the number of TH positive neurons in substantia nigra in the sevoflurane pretreatment+PD group was more than that in the PD group,the differences w
